Whale Watching
Season: December to April
Cabo is one of the best places in the world to see gray whales, which migrate through the area every winter. Take a guided tour from January to March for an unforgettable experience.
- Tips: Early morning tours offer better whale spotting opportunities.
- Best spot: Depart from Marina Cabo San Lucas or Puerto Los Cabos.

Sea Lion Encounters
Get up close with these playful creatures at the Cabo San Lucas Marina. You can even snorkel or scuba dive alongside them!
- Tips: Don’t touch or feed the sea lions, as this can harm both humans and animals.
- Best spot: Visit the marina’s designated area for sea lion encounters.
Turtle Conservation
Support conservation efforts by visiting a protected turtle nesting site. Learn about these incredible creatures and their habitats.
- Tips: Respect the turtles’ habitat and follow guides to ensure a safe and enjoyable experience.
- Best time: Visit during turtle hatching season (June to August).
